PKR drowns again: lost 1.09 against Dollar  

PKRSource: File

Web Desk (LTN NEWS): PKR continued to lose value on Tuesday. During morning trade on the interbank market, the PKR lost another Rs1.09 per dollar.

Forex Association of Pakistan says that at 11:45 a.m., the exchange rate for the local currency was Rs239 per dollar (FAP). From yesterday’s close of Rs237.91, this is a drop of 0.45%, bringing the PKR close to its all-time low of Rs239.94 on July 28.

General Secretary of the Exchange Companies Association of Pakistan (Ecap) Zafar Paracha said that banks’ speculation was to blame for the rupee’s fall. He said that banks “made a year’s worth of profits in two months.”

He asked the State Bank of Pakistan (SBP) to go after banks instead of just a few exchange companies to “save face.” The Escape general secretary also asked the government to change its trade and immigration policies with Afghanistan and Iran, saying that they were “eating up our foreign reserves and revenues.

Since Sep 2, the rupee has gone down in value every day. Since July 1, the value of the rupee has dropped by 13.9 percent, or Rs33, according to data from the financial data and analytics site Mettis Global.

PKR has lost 29.17% of its value against the dollar over the past 52 weeks. On July 28, it hit a record low of Rs239.94.
